The Samsung Belt is expanding as an industrial corridor stretching from Suwon, Hwaseong, Yongin, and Pyeongtaek to Cheonan and Asan, spanning the southern part of the Seoul metropolitan area and northern Chungcheong. Suwon is the original satellite city, anchored by Samsung Electronics Digital City. Hwaseong is a representative semiconductor residential area, home to both Samsung Electronics Giheung and Hwaseong Campuses as well as Dongtan New Town. Yongin is seeing its future industrial axis expand due to the creation of the National Advanced System Semiconductor Cluster. Pyeongtaek continues to see demand centered on Samsung Electronics Pyeongtaek Campus and Godeok International New City. Cheonan and Asan form the Samsung Belt in the Chungcheong region, with Samsung Electronics Onyang Plant, Samsung Display, and Samsung SDI, all forming an ecosystem where semiconductor back-end processing, display, and secondary battery industries operate together.


In Asan, the Samsung Electronics Onyang Plant, Samsung Display, and Samsung SDI are all located. In particular, the Samsung Electronics Onyang Plant is known as a key site responsible for back-end processes such as semiconductor packaging and inspection. Recently, as demand for AI semiconductors and high-bandwidth memory increases in the semiconductor market, the importance of advanced packaging technology is growing, raising expectations that the role of the Onyang Plant will further expand.

Against this backdrop, Hanseong Construction plans to launch sales of 'Cheonan Asan Station Grand City Philhouse Block 1' at Joint Block 1, Hyudae District, Baebang-eup, Asan-si, Chungnam, in June. The development will consist of 14 buildings ranging from two basement levels to up to 28 floors above ground, with exclusive use areas of 84㎡ and 103㎡. Out of a total of 1,534 units, 1,380 units will be offered for general sale.


Grand City in the Hyudae District, where the complex will be built, is a new residential area being developed south of Cheonan Asan Station. It is close to the Buldang and Tangjeong living zones and is also linked to key industrial hubs such as Samsung Electronics Onyang Plant, Samsung Display, and Samsung SDI.
